In Search of the Wolf
Saturday 22 March 2008 10:30-11:00 (Radio 4 FM)
Nick Barraclough recalls the first pirate radio stations which sprung up across the Rio Grande in Mexico in the 1950s.
He tells the stories of Pappy Lee O'Daniel, who used station XER to sell flour and become Senator for Texas, the preachers who sold splinters from the cross and signed photographs of Jesus Christ, and Wolfman Jack, the man who would go on to become the first great rock 'n' roll DJ.
